Abstract

Marga Dajan Puri Village is located in the Marga District of Tabanan Regency. The livelihoods of the village residents are quite diverse, with the majority engaged in agriculture and plantations. Based on the initiative of several villagers, they formed a group to cultivate Organic Seedless Israeli Lemon, consisting of 13 farmers led by Mr. I Made Suastika. The products they produce include lemon fruit, grafted seedlings, and organic fertilizer. There are several issues related to the management of this business, namely the lack of financial record-keeping, the absence of a promotional system to market their products, and production equipment that is already in disrepair. The activities conducted to assist this lemon farmer group include providing training and support for simple financial record-keeping, creating an online marketing promotion strategy, and procuring some new equipment. The goal of this service activity is to enhance the partners' understanding of business financial record-keeping and marketing, as well as to improve their production capacity. The expected outcomes of this activity include the implementation of simple bookkeeping, increased business turnover, production volume, and market share. The targets to be achieved are: enhanced competitiveness, increased turnover and added value for UMKM, application of science and technology in UMKM, publication in national/international journals, online media publication, and uploading videos on YouTube channels
